WebA common-size income statement is usually created alongside a regular income statement. The top line on the income statement provides the base figure for the calculations. All other line items are expressed as a percentage of the base figure. Sporty Shoes Income Statement: Sales Revenue. £100K. 100%. Cost of Goods Sold. WebSep 9, 2024 · It is a useful tool to evaluate the trend situations. The statements for two or more periods are used in horizontal analysis. The earliest period is usually used as the base period and the items on the statements for all later periods are compared with items on the statements of the base period. WebNov 9, 2024 · Consider the following example of comparative income statement analysis. If you made $45,000 in 2024 and $50,000 in 2024, the dollar change is $5,000. Then, divide the dollar change by the base year profit. In this case, the base year profit is $45,000 for 2024. The result is 0.11 ($5,000 / $45,000 = 0.11).
